zIIP Exploitation Beyond DB2
DataDirect’s unique, patent-pending technology enables exploitation of IBM's specialty engines, the zIIP and zAAP, both of which are unmeasured, non-speed restricted processing environments. With Shadow, processing data intensive workloads in support of Business Intelligence or ERP applications can be diverted from the mainframe’s General Purpose Processor to the zIIP specialty engine, thereby reducing MSU utilization. Shadow opens up the zIIP to additional workloads beyond DB2, to include IMS, VSAM, Adabas, IDMS, as well as SOAP/XML parsing for the transformation of business logic and screen logic in Web services. Product Description
Shadow z/Direct transforms mainframe data and business logic assets into reusable virtual RDBMS objects. Data assets are transformed into virtual RDBMS tables while business logic assets are transformed into virtual RDBMS stored procedures. Shadow z/Direct provides developers with direct, SQL access to mainframe data and applications (business logic and screens) utilizing industry standard ODBC, JDBC or JCA (J2EE Connector Architecture) APIs.
